What is nRF52832? How to use nRF52832?

What is nRF52832? nRF52832 is a multi-purpose system-on-chip (SoC) developed by Nordic Semiconductor and is widely used in the Internet of Things (IoT) and low-power wireless communication applications. It is part of Nordic Semiconductor's nRF52 series of chips, which feature excellent wireless connectivity, low power consumption, and powerful processing performance.

Power Integrity (PI) Design and Test Methodology

Power Integrity (PI) Design and Test Methodology Power integrity (Power Integrity, referred to as PI) is a very important part of electronic system design, especially high-speed digital systems. PI is generally concerned with ensuring that the various components in the system receive clear, clean, and constant power. To this end, a suitable power distribution network (Power Distribution Network, PDN) needs to be designed and tested to ensure that its performance is up to standard.
